Abstract

The application discloses a heating body, an atomizing device and a preparation method of the heating body, wherein the heating body comprises a base electrode, a cover electrode and a two-dimensional material body; the two-dimensional material body is vacuum sealed between the cover electrode and the base electrode and is in electrical contact with both of them. Firstly, the two-dimensional material body has the characteristics of high resistance, small instantaneous impact current and the like, and the electrical contact relationship with the electrode, so that the heat generated by the two-dimensional material body can be directly and quickly transmitted to the base electrode or the cover electrode, the heating body realizes the heating function, and the thermoelectric conversion efficiency of the heating body is effectively improved. Secondly, the two-dimensional material body is arranged in the form of vacuum sealing in the heating body, the two-dimensional material body can be prevented from being oxidized in high-temperature working, and the characteristics of high heat resistance and stability in a vacuum atmosphere are fully utilized, so that the two-dimensional material body or the whole heating body can long-term play its unique electrical and thermal advantages, and the stable, reliable and long-term high-temperature application of the heating body is ensured.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of heat-not-burn, in particular to a heating body, an atomization device and a preparation method of the heating body. BACKGROUND

[0002] Taking a heat-not-burn atomization device as an example, the heating body (also referred to as a heating element) is one of the core components of the atomization device, which serves to heat the aerosol generating substrate to a specific temperature range to generate aerosol for use. Therefore, the performance of the heating body has a crucial influence on the overall performance of the atomization device.

[0003] The existing heating body often adopts a metal thick film heating material or a metal thin layer sheet heating material. The metal thick film heating material usually refers to a heating material body formed by sequentially printing and high-temperature sintering an electrically insulating material layer, a heating resistance material layer, an electrode layer and a surface protection layer on a metal substrate by a screen printing process. The metal thin layer sheet heating material usually refers to a heating material body formed by wrapping a heating film on a metal substrate, and the heating film is usually a planar heating element composed of an electrically insulating material and a heating electronic material arranged therein. In actual application, the existing heating body generally has problems such as low thermoelectric conversion efficiency and poor long-term working reliability at high temperature. SUMMARY

[0059] Two-dimensional material generally refers to a kind of material in which electrons can only move freely in two dimensions at nanometer scale (1-100 nm), such as a kind of material represented by graphite or graphene; the two-dimensional material has unique thermal and electrical characteristics such as fast heat transfer and small instantaneous impact current when starting, although the two-dimensional material has been applied in some optoelectronic device fields, but has not been stably and reliably applied in the field of heating non-combustion.

[0060] The heating body provided in the application is characterized in that the two-dimensional material body is packaged in a vacuum-sealed form between the base electrode and the cover electrode; on the one hand, by means of the electrical contact relationship between the two-dimensional material body and the base electrode and the cover electrode, the two-dimensional material body can be quickly heated or heated by applying a potential difference to the base electrode and the cover electrode, so as to directly and quickly transfer heat to the base electrode or the cover electrode, thereby effectively improving the thermoelectric conversion efficiency of the heating body.

[0061] On the other hand, since the two-dimensional material body is packaged in a vacuum-sealed form between the base electrode and the cover electrode, the base electrode and the cover electrode can form effective protection for the two-dimensional material body to prevent the two-dimensional material body from being oxidized by oxidizing gases such as air when working at high temperature, thereby ensuring that the two-dimensional material body can stably exert its unique thermal and electrical advantages for a long time, and further effectively improving the heat resistance, stability and reliability of the heating body during long-term work.

[0062] Please refer to Figures 1 to 12 The embodiment of the application provides a heating body which can be used as an electrothermal device in a heating non-combustion atomization device, a household electric heating device and the like; the heating body comprises a base electrode 10, a cover electrode 20, a two-dimensional material body 30 and other components as needed, which will be described below.

[0063] Please refer to Figures 1 to 12 The base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 can adopt different structural forms according to the design of the overall profile of the heating body, the application scene of the heating body and the like; for example, please refer to Figures 2 to 6 The base electrode 10 adopts a tubular structure (i.e. a hollow pipe material), and the cover electrode 20 adopts a tubular structure or a sheet structure, and the cover electrode 20 is arranged on the outer periphery of the base electrode 10 or is stacked on the outer peripheral wall of the base electrode 10, so as to form a tubular heating body; for another example, please refer to Figure 10 The base electrode 10 adopts a columnar structure (or a needle-like structure), and the cover electrode 20 adopts a tubular structure or a sheet structure, and the cover electrode 20 is arranged on the outer periphery of the base electrode 10 or is stacked on the outer peripheral wall of the base electrode, so as to form a needle columnar heating body; for another example, please refer to Figure 1 The base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 both adopt a sheet structure, and are arranged in a stacked manner, so as to form a sheet-shaped heating body.

[0064] Please refer to Figures 1 to 12 The two-dimensional material body 30 is mainly used as an electrocaloric element in the heating body, and can be a film sheet structure of graphite, graphene, molybdenum sulfide, tungsten sulfide, cubic boron arsenide, boron nitride, boron phosphide, tantalum nitride, etc. In specific implementation, the two-dimensional material body 30 can specifically select a two-dimensional material whose resistance value in the thickness direction is at least 10 times, 100 times or 1000 times larger than the resistance value in the length direction or the width direction, or it can also be understood that the interlayer resistance of the two-dimensional material body 30 is at least 10 times or 100 times larger than the intralayer resistance. The two-dimensional material body 30 is arranged between the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, and the two surfaces of the two-dimensional material body 30 opposite in the thickness direction are respectively in electrical contact with the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 on the corresponding side (for example, to achieve electrical contact in a close-fitting manner, or to achieve electrical contact between the two-dimensional material body 30 and the electrode through a conductive layer arranged therebetween).

[0065] By connecting the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 to the power supply, the heating body and the power supply form a complete electrical circuit. Since the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 are located on the two sides of the two-dimensional material body 30 in the thickness direction, when the heating body is powered on, the current will flow in the thickness direction of the two-dimensional material body 30 to take advantage of the high resistance characteristics of the two-dimensional material body 30 in the thickness direction, thereby causing the two-dimensional material body 20 to heat up quickly or generate heat, and transferring heat to the base electrode 10 and / or the cover electrode 20. For tubular or sheet-shaped heating bodies, the base electrode 10 or the cover electrode 20 can ultimately be used to heat or atomize the medium to be processed (such as aerosol generating substrate, airflow, etc.); for needle columnar heating bodies, the cover electrode 20 can ultimately be used to heat or atomize the medium to be processed.

[0066] For the sake of distinction and description, the side of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 facing each other is defined as the joint surface, and the joint surface is divided into a first region and a second region after functional region division; that is, the joint surface of the base electrode 10 and the joint surface of the cover electrode 20 both have or are divided into a first region and a second region; wherein the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10 establish a structural connection relationship with each other in the first region, and the second region can be understood as the region corresponding to the two-dimensional material body 30. For example, when the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 both adopt a tubular structure, taking the base electrode 10 as the description object, the first region thereof can be the region part of the outer peripheral surface of the base electrode 10 located at the two axial ends, or it can be a region part located at the two axial ends of the inner peripheral surface of the base electrode 10, or it can be a region part located at the two axial ends of the outer peripheral surface of the cover electrode 20, or it can be a region part located at the two axial ends of the inner peripheral surface of the cover electrode 20. Figure 11The end face portions of the axial two ends of the base electrode 10 shown; for example, the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 both adopt a sheet structure, and the first regions of both refer to the region portions distributed around the two-dimensional material body 30 or the region portions located at the geometric contour periphery of the two-dimensional material body 30.

[0067] By means of vacuumizing treatment between the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10 and sealing and fixing the first region of the cover electrode 20 and the first region of the base electrode 10, etc., the two-dimensional material body 30 is finally encapsulated in a vacuum-sealed form between the second region of the base electrode 10 and the second region of the cover electrode 20, and it is ensured that the two-dimensional material body 30 can maintain electrical contact (for example, close contact) with the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, respectively.

[0068] In specific implementation, the region where the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 directly contact each other is provided with electrical insulation, for example, an electrical insulation material layer 40 is arranged in the first region of the base electrode 10 and / or the first region of the cover electrode 20, or the first region of at least one of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 is made of an electrical insulation material; not only can short circuit caused by direct contact between the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 be prevented, but also it is ensured that the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 are electrically connected through the two-dimensional material body 30.

[0069] Then the two-dimensional material body 30 and the cover electrode 20 are placed on the base electrode 10 in sequence, and the two-dimensional material body 30 is located between the second region of the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10; wherein the number of two-dimensional material bodies 30 can be one or multiple, and multiple two-dimensional material bodies 30 are arranged at intervals on the base electrode 10 (in other words, the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 can both have multiple second regions arranged at intervals).

[0070] By means of vacuum welding, vacuum fixing and other process means, the first region of the cover electrode 20 and the first region of the base electrode 10 are sealed and fixed, so that the two-dimensional material body 30 can be vacuum sealed or vacuum encapsulated between the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10 under the action of pressure difference, and it is ensured that the two surfaces of the two-dimensional material body 30 in the thickness direction maintain, for example, close electrical contact and close contact relationship with the corresponding side base electrode 10 and cover electrode 20, respectively.

[0071] On one hand, the two-dimensional material body 30 has a high resistance value along its thickness direction, a small impulse current at the start, and other characteristics. By applying a potential difference to the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 to ohmically heat the two-dimensional material body 30, the two-dimensional material body 30 is heated or heated and quickly reaches the upper limit of the heating temperature. At the same time, with the electrical contact relationship between the two-dimensional material body 30 and the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, it is ensured that heat can be quickly transferred to the base electrode 10 and / or the cover electrode 20, so as to ultimately realize the heating or heating function of the heating body to the outside.

[0072] On the other hand, the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 directly vacuum package and protect the two-dimensional material body 30. This can prevent the two-dimensional material body 30 from being oxidized at high temperature, and take advantage of the fact that the two-dimensional material body 30 has strong heat-resistant stability in a vacuum or reducing atmosphere, so that the two-dimensional material body 30 and even the entire heating body can long-term play its unique thermal and electrical advantages, and provide protection for the stable and reliable long-term high-temperature application of the heating body.

[0074] In one embodiment, please refer to Figures 2 to 4The heating body is a tubular structure. Specifically, the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 are both made of conductive material and have a substantially tubular structure. The outer diameter of the base electrode 10 is slightly smaller than the inner diameter of the cover electrode 20, and the wall thickness of the cover electrode 20 is smaller than that of the base electrode 10. The base electrode 10 can be made of oxygen-free copper pipe, double-layer metal composite pipe with an outer layer of oxygen-free copper, pure aluminum or aluminum alloy pipe, double-layer metal composite pipe with an outer layer of pure aluminum or aluminum alloy, stainless steel pipe (such as SUS430, SUS444, SUS304, SUS316, etc.), Kovar alloy pipe, etc. The cover electrode 20 can be made of thin-walled copper pipe, thin-walled copper pipe with an outer layer of plating (such as nickel, gold, iridium, etc.), thin-walled Kovar alloy pipe, thin-walled pure aluminum or aluminum alloy pipe, thin-walled pure aluminum or aluminum alloy pipe with an outer layer of plating (such as nickel, gold, silver, iridium, etc.), thin-walled titanium alloy pipe, thin-walled stainless steel pipe (such as SUS430, SUS444, SUS304, SUS316, etc.), etc.

[0075] In terms of the overall structure of the heating body, the cover electrode 20 is coaxially sleeved on the outer periphery of the base electrode 10. The outer peripheral surface or outer wall surface of the base electrode 10 is the joint surface of the base electrode 10, and the inner peripheral surface or inner wall surface of the cover electrode 20 is the joint surface of the cover electrode 20. The c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10 are sealingly and fixedly connected at the peripheral surface parts at the two axial ends. One or more two-dimensional material bodies 30 are vacuum sealed or encapsulated between the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10.

[0076] In specific implementation, the two-dimensional material body 30 can be positioned in advance on the second region of the outer peripheral surface of the base electrode 10, and then the cover electrode 20 is sleeved on the base electrode 10. By pumping out the air between the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, the cover electrode 20 collapses under the action of the pressure difference, so that the two-dimensional material body 30 is tightly attached between the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10. Subsequently, the peripheral surface parts at the two axial ends of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 are sealingly and fixedly connected, so that the two-dimensional material body 30 is finally vacuum sealed and encapsulated.

[0077] Of course, the two-dimensional material body 30 can also be entirely covered between the peripheral surfaces of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20. Please refer to Figure 11 At this time, the extension a extending radially outward can be arranged at the ports at the two axial ends of the base electrode 10, or the extension a extending radially inward can be arranged at the breaks at the two axial ends of the cover electrode 20. The two-dimensional material body 30 is finally vacuum sealed between the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 by the abutting relationship between the extension a and the port surface of the corresponding base electrode 10 or cover electrode 20.

[0078] Another embodiment, please refer to Figure 5 and Figure 6 The profile shape of the base electrode 10 is generally a tubular structure of conductive material, and the profile shape of the cover electrode 20 is generally a plate or sheet structure, such as a foil sheet material of conductive material; the cover electrode 20 is sealed and fixed to the partial area of the outer peripheral surface of the base electrode 10 in the form of covering the two-dimensional material body 30. It can be understood that at this time, the first area of the base electrode 10 can be other areas of the outer peripheral surface thereof except the covered area of the two-dimensional material body 30 (see Figure 5 for details), or the partial area of the first area of the outer peripheral surface thereof facing the cover electrode 20 (see Figure 6 for details); that is, the area of the cover electrode 20 outside the geometric profile of the two-dimensional material body 30 is its first area, and is sealed and fixed to the outer wall surface of the base electrode 10.

[0079] In specific implementation, the number of the cover electrode 20 and the two-dimensional material body 30 can be set to be multiple, and multiple cover electrodes 20 and their corresponding two-dimensional material bodies 30 are arranged at different positions of the peripheral surface of the base electrode 10.

[0080] One embodiment, please refer to Figure 1 , Figure 7 and Figure 12 The heating body is a plate structure, specifically, the profile shape of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 is generally a plate or sheet structure of conductive material, for example, the base electrode 10 is a plate material with a predetermined thickness, and the cover electrode 20 is a foil sheet material with a thickness smaller than that of the base electrode 10; the two-dimensional material body 20 can be arranged on one side or both sides of the base electrode 10, and the cover electrode 20 is sealed and fixed to the base electrode 10 in the form of covering the two-dimensional material body 30.

[0081] One embodiment, please refer to Figures 1 to 12 The first area of the base electrode 10 and / or the cover electrode 20 is made of electrically insulating material, and the second area of the base electrode 10 and / or the cover electrode 20 is made of conductive material; for example, the base electrode 10 is made of conductive material such as metal or alloy, the first area of the cover electrode 20 is made of electrically insulating material, and the second area is made of conductive material; thus, while preventing short circuit caused by direct contact between the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, it is ensured that the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 are electrically connected through the two-dimensional material body 30.

[0082] In other embodiments, the base electrode 10 can also adopt a needle column structure, and the cover electrode 20 adopts a tubular structure or a sheet structure to form a needle column-shaped heating body; for details, please refer to the foregoing embodiments, which will not be repeated here.

[0083] In one embodiment, referring to Figure 7 and Figure 12 and in combination with Figures 1 to 6 and Figure 10 and Figure 11 , the second region of the base electrode 10 is provided with a containing chamber 10a, which is mainly used for accommodating and positioning a corresponding two-dimensional material body 30. Specifically, the containing chamber 10a can be used by providing a groove structure with the same or substantially the same profile as the two-dimensional material body 30 in the second region of the base electrode 10 (which can be recessed on the surface of the base electrode 10 or protrude from the surface of the base electrode 10); during the heating body preparation process, at least part of the corresponding two-dimensional material body 30 (for example, part of the two-dimensional material body 30 is embedded in the containing chamber 10a, and the other part protrudes from the bonding surface of the base electrode 10) is accommodated by the containing chamber 10a, so as to preliminarily position and arrange the two-dimensional material body 30 on the base electrode 10; then the cover electrode 20 is arranged, and subsequent vacuumizing and sealing are performed, so as to form a structure in which the base electrode 10, the two-dimensional material body 30 and the cover electrode 20 are vacuum-sealed and attached.

[0084] In other embodiments, based on the selection of the heating body preparation process, the containing chamber 10a can also be provided in the second region of the cover electrode 20, alone or simultaneously, which will not be described herein.

[0085] Referring to Figures 1 to 12 , in the embodiment in which the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 are both made of conductive materials, the first region of the base electrode 10 is provided with an electrically insulating material layer 40, which is mainly used for electrically insulating the base electrode 10 from the cover electrode 20; the electrically insulating material layer 40 can be made of an aluminum nitride layer, a diamond layer, a glass ceramic, an aluminum oxide layer, a chromium oxide layer, etc. based on the specific material types of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20; and according to the specific material of the electrically insulating material layer 40, the electrically insulating material layer 40 can be formed on the base electrode 10 by sputtering, spraying, printing, nitriding, oxidation, etc. In addition, in the embodiment in which the containing chamber 10a is provided, the electrically insulating material layer 40 can extend to the cavity wall of the containing chamber 10a, so that the front and back surfaces of the two-dimensional material body 30 directly contact the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10, thereby ensuring that the parts of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 that can directly contact each other are insulated from each other.

[0086] In another embodiment, based on the difference in the heating body preparation process, the first region of the cover electrode 20 can also be provided with an electrically insulating material layer 40, alone or simultaneously.

[0087] In one embodiment, referring to Figure 8 and Figure 9The first region of the base electrode 10 is further provided with a compensation structure 10b. The compensation structure 10b can be one or more groove structures arranged at intervals on the bonding surface of the base electrode 10, or can be one or more protrusion structures arranged at intervals on the bonding surface of the base electrode 10. On the one hand, the compensation structure 10b can effectively increase the direct contact area between the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, and ensure that the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 can be firmly sealed and fixed. On the other hand, the compensation structure 10b can compensate for the deformation of the cover electrode 20. Specifically, during vacuum welding or vacuum release, the cover electrode 20 will collapse due to the pressure difference and fit the compensation structure 10b (for example, partially enter the groove form of the compensation structure 10b), so that the cover electrode 20 can wrap the two-dimensional material body 30 like a heat-shrinkable film.

[0088] In a specific implementation, taking the groove form of the compensation structure 10b as an example, the total groove area of the compensation structure 10b depends on the spacing difference between the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10. For example, the larger the difference between the outer diameter of the base electrode 10 (including the electrically insulating material layer 40) and the inner diameter of the cover electrode 20, the larger the total groove area of the compensation structure 10b. Thus, the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10 can be in sufficient contact and sealed.

[0089] In one embodiment, referring to Figure 12 and combining Figures 1 to 11 The two-dimensional material body 30, the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 can also be in non-direct contact with each other. Specifically, a first conductive layer 50 is arranged between the cover electrode 20 (specifically, the second region thereof) and the two-dimensional material body 30 to realize electrical contact between the cover electrode 20 and the two-dimensional material body 30. A second conductive layer 60 is arranged between the base electrode 10 (specifically, the second region thereof) and the two-dimensional material body 30 to realize electrical contact between the base electrode 10 and the two-dimensional material body 30. The two-dimensional material body 30 can be a single two-dimensional material film structure or a multi-layer film structure formed by stacking different two-dimensional materials. The first conductive layer 50 and the second conductive layer 60 can be formed on the surface of the two-dimensional material body 30, the cover electrode 20 or the base electrode 10 in the form of a film. For example, the first conductive layer 50 and the second conductive layer 60 can be metal films (such as copper, gold, platinum, iridium, etc.) with high conductivity.

[0090] The first conductive layer 50 and the second conductive layer 60 are used to establish a close electrical contact between the two-dimensional material body 30 and the cover electrode 20 (and / or the base electrode 10), so as to ensure the ohmic heating effect of the two-dimensional material body 30.

[0091] In specific implementation, the first conductive layer 50 and the second conductive layer 60 can be made of conductive materials with the same or different thermal conductivities, which can depend on whether the heating body is used to heat or atomize the medium to be treated based on the base electrode 10 or the cover electrode 20.

[0092] For example, when the heating body is in a tubular structure and is used to heat or atomize the medium to be treated based on the base electrode 10, the second conductive layer 60 can be made of a conductive material layer with high thermal conductivity (e.g., a heat-conducting conductive material), and the first conductive layer 50 can be made of a conductive material layer with low thermal conductivity (e.g., a heat-insulating conductive material), so as to enhance the heat transfer between the two-dimensional material body 30 and the base electrode 10 and the heat insulation between the two-dimensional material body 30 and the cover electrode 20, and make the heat generated by the two-dimensional material body 30 be transmitted to the base electrode 10 as much as possible, so as to heat or atomize the medium to be treated based on the base electrode 10.

[0093] For example, when the heating body is in a needle columnar or sheet structure and is used to heat or atomize the medium to be treated based on the cover electrode 20, the second conductive layer 60 can be made of a conductive material layer with low thermal conductivity, and the first conductive layer 50 can be made of a conductive material layer with high thermal conductivity, so as to make the heat generated by the two-dimensional material body 30 be transmitted to the cover electrode 20 as much as possible, so as to heat or atomize the medium to be treated based on the cover electrode 20.

[0094] It should be noted that, in some embodiments, the surfaces (especially the parts exposed to the heating body) of the base electrode 10, the cover electrode 20 and the electrically insulating material layer 40 can also be provided with a protective material layer to prevent oxidation during high-temperature operation or contact with the medium; for example, for the tubular base electrode 10 and cover electrode 20, an anti-oxidation protective layer can be plated on the inner wall surface of the base electrode 10 and the outer wall surface of the cover electrode 20 to prevent rusting; for example, for the cover electrode 20 in a foil sheet structure, an anti-oxidation protective film can be plated on the electrically insulating material layer 40 to avoid damage to the area of the electrically insulating material layer 40 not covered by the cover electrode 20.

[0095] Please refer to Figure 13 and in combination with Figures 1 to 12 The application further provides a preparation method of the heating body, which can be used to prepare the heating body of any of the preceding embodiments; the preparation method comprises steps 100 to 500, which are described below.

[0096] Step 100, selecting the base material of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, and the specific two-dimensional material body 30.

[0097] According to the specific application and structural form of the heating body, the base material of the base electrode 10 can be selected from copper-based, aluminum-based, stainless steel-based, Kovar alloy-based pipe, plate or column material, and the base material of the cover electrode 20 can be selected from thin-walled pipe or foil sheet of metal material. The two-dimensional material film sheet with an interlayer resistivity of 500-2000 times of the intralayer resistivity can be selected as the two-dimensional material body 30; for example, the interlayer resistivity of the molybdenum sulfide nanofilm sheet is about 2200 times of the intralayer resistivity, and the interlayer resistivity of the graphite film sheet is about 500 times of the intralayer resistivity.

[0098] Specifically, taking the preparation of a heating body with a long-term working temperature up to 400℃ as an example, the physical parameters of the two-dimensional material body 30 can be selected or configured with reference to Table 1.

[0099]

[0100] Step 200, setting the accommodation chamber 10a on the second region of the base material of the base electrode 10 and / or the base material of the cover electrode 20.

[0101] For example, the recess structure with the same or approximately the same contour shape as the two-dimensional material body 30 can be set on the preset region (i.e., the second region) of the outer peripheral surface of the base electrode 10 by machining or other process means to form the accommodation chamber 10a; in order to ensure the setting space of the corresponding components or material layers, the size of the accommodation chamber 10a can be slightly larger than the size of the two-dimensional material body 30; and the two-dimensional material body 30 is allowed to have a small gap between the two-dimensional material body 30 and the side wall of the accommodation chamber 10a after being embedded in the accommodation chamber 10a.

[0102] At the same time, a plurality of recess structures can also be set on the first region of the outer peripheral surface of the base electrode 10 to form the compensation structure 10b.

[0103] Step 300, electrically insulating the first region of the base electrode 10 and / or the first region of the cover electrode 20.

[0104] In order to prevent the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 from being short-circuited due to direct contact, thereby causing problems such as damage to the heating body, failure of the two-dimensional material body 30 to heat or poor heating effect, etc., the region / portion of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 directly contacting each other needs to be electrically insulated.

[0105] For example, the bottom surface of the accommodating chamber 10a of the base electrode 10 can be protected or shielded in advance, and then an electrically insulating material is prepared or fixed on the base electrode 10 by means of sputtering, spraying, printing, nitriding, oxidation, etc., to form an electrically insulating material layer 40 on the base electrode 10; or the first region of the base electrode 10 and / or the first region of the cover electrode 20 is made of an electrically insulating material.

[0106] Step 400: sequentially arrange the two-dimensional material body 30 and the cover electrode 20 on the base electrode 10, so that the two-dimensional material body 30 is located between the second region of the base electrode 10 and the second region of the cover electrode 20.

[0107] Specifically, the two-dimensional material body 30 can be first positioned and placed in the second region of the base electrode 10 (for example, inserted into the corresponding accommodating chamber 10a), and then the brazing filler metal is arranged at the predetermined position (i.e., the position to be welded) of the first region of the base electrode 10 and / or the cover electrode 20, and finally the cover electrode 20 is sleeved or stacked on the base electrode 10 in a manner of covering the two-dimensional material body 30.

[0108] Among them, the brazing filler metal can be prepared at the position to be welded by means of dispensing, screen printing, spraying or other suitable methods, or can be pre-prepared at a specific position in the first region of the cover electrode 20, or can be a sheet that can be directly placed between the first regions of the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20.

[0109] Among them, in the case that the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20 both adopt a tubular structure, the cover electrode 20 can be heated to a predetermined temperature (for example, 50-200°C) by means of a hot air gun or a heating device, so that the cover electrode 20 is deformed due to expansion caused by heating; and then the cover electrode 20 is quickly cooled after being sleeved on the base electrode 10, or the cold base electrode 10 is quickly sleeved, so that the two-dimensional material body 30 is wrapped and adhered between the cover electrode 20 and the base electrode 10 by the shrinkage deformation of the cover electrode 20 caused by cooling.

[0110] Step 500: fix and seal the first region of the base electrode 10 and the first region of the cover electrode 20 in a vacuum environment, so as to vacuum-seal the two-dimensional material body 30 between the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, and make the two-dimensional material body 30 tightly contact and adhere to the base electrode 10 and the cover electrode 20, respectively.
